Carolyn Whitney, MD is a pediatrician at South Third Primary Care and an instructor in Nursing-Primary/Public Health Department at University of Tennessee Health Science Center. Dr. Whitney received her medical degree from Meharry Medical College in Nashville, TN and completed her residency at Children’s Hospital of Michigan in Detroit, MI. She is a member of the American Academy of Pediatrics and Bluff City Medical Society.
